Sialia 57 Electric Yacht

Polish builder Sialia calls their 57-foot day boat "Deep Silence" for good reason. Available with up to a megawatt of battery power, she'll run to Bimini and back with juice to spare—in near silent luxury. Take a tour with us at the 2025 Miami Boat Show.
